The Science Behind Our Clean Water Extraction Process
With cleaning up after a Category 1 clean water event, every minute counts. Our team follows a strict process to reduce damage and prevent secondary issues. We’ll start by containing the affected area to prevent further water damage. Next, we’ll use advanced equipment to detect moisture levels and extract the water. We’ll then dry out the area using specialized equipment and monitor the process to ensure everything is dry and safe.
Step 1: Containment
We’ll set up a containment system to prevent further water damage and contain the affected area. This involves sealing off the area with plastic sheets and using sandbags to prevent water from spreading. Our technicians will work quickly to contain the area, reducing the risk of further damage.
Step 2: Moisture Detection
We’ll use specialized equipment to detect moisture levels in the affected area. This involves using non-invasive moisture detection tools to identify areas with high moisture levels. Our technicians will use this information to find out the best course of action for extraction and drying.
Step 3: Extraction
We’ll use advanced extraction equipment to remove the water from the affected area. This may involve using pumps, vacuums, or other specialized equipment to extract the water. Our technicians will work quickly to extract as much water as possible, reducing the risk of further damage.
Step 4: Drying
We’ll use specialized equipment to dry out the affected area. This may involve using dehumidifiers, air movers, or other equipment to remove excess moisture from the area. Our technicians will monitor the drying process to ensure everything is dry and safe.

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) Cost in Lovejoy, GA
The cost of clean water extraction (Category 1) varies dep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Lovejoy, GA. Our estimates are based on real-world costs and can vary from $500 to $2,500 or more, depending on the situ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Containment and cleanup |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the complexity of the cleanup. |
| Moisture detection and assessment | $200 – $1,000 | The severity of the damage and the number of areas affected. |
| Extraction and drying | $1,000 – $5,000 | The amount of water extracted and the size of the affected area. |
| Equipment rental and labor | $500 – $2,000 | The type and quantity of equipment needed, as well as labor costs. |
| Treatment and disinfection | $200 – $1,000 | The extent of the treatment and disinfection required. |
